OTTAWA – Independent MP Han Dong was suddenly reminded by his wife days before his testimony at the Public Inquiry into Foreign Interference that a bus of international students, likely of Chinese descent, had voted in his nomination contest for Don Valley North in 2019.
Dong testified at the public inquiry on Tuesday. His team sent a written submission to the inquiry the day prior, on April 1, six weeks after he was interviewed by the commission’s lawyers.
